High-Profile Mexican Prosecutor Assassinated in Daylight Ambush

In a shocking display of brazen violence, Ernesto Vazquez Reyna, a prominent Mexican prosecutor, was brutally gunned down while driving his Cadillac through the streets of Mexico. The daylight attack has sent shockwaves through the country's legal community and raised serious concerns about the escalating power of drug cartels.

A Targeted Execution

Eyewitnesses described a horrifying scene as multiple assailants surrounded Reyna's vehicle and opened fire with automatic weapons. The prosecutor, known for his work on high-profile organized crime cases, stood no chance against the hail of bullets that pierced his luxury car.

Key details of the attack:

  • Occurred in broad daylight on a busy street
  • Multiple gunmen involved in the coordinated assault
  • Victim was driving his distinctive Cadillac at the time
  • No immediate arrests made following the shooting
